We shouldnt allow the creation of an emtpy Smtp Server(with hostname being
null), through the add smtp server dialog.

1. Open Outgoing Server settings
2. Click Advanced - Advanced Outgoing Server Settings dialog opens
3. Click Add - SMTP Server dialog opens
4. Don't enter any data at all and click OK

Results: an empty entry is created! On the Advanced Outgoing Server Settings 
dialog, you can highlight the last row, which is blank.

Expected: What is required data here? A Server Name and a Port? If the user 
clicks OK and BOTH of these fields have not had data entered into them, show a 
dialog:

Title: <ProductName>
Message: A server name and port must be entered.
Button: OK
"Please enter a valid server name" seems to be more appropriate with the rest of
account manager/wizard alerts. Is that ok with you?
>"Please enter a valid server name"
Yes, better :-)  Does a valid port need to be entered as well? Or only a server?
Port is not necessary and hence only a check for server name is sufficient.
